89 camaro: resistance going uphill

I have a 1989 camaro RS v6 that i'm getting from a dealer. the guy selling the car to me said the car drives fine on flat land but it wants to putt soon as he gives a load to it by driving it up hill. any possibilities? thanks.

Hello safireking88!!

Have you driven it up a hill yet???

It could be having some issues with the valve body in the transmission, torque converter, or even the "TV" cable, etc....!!!

If your getting it from a dealer, it should be fixed before you get it, at their expense!!

Make sure that if you do get it, that there is a warranty on the transmission/drive train!!

I'd walk, and find another, however if the price was right, and you had other plans for the car, the transmission "problem" may be of no concern to you!!
